Joe Ann Williams Hayworth
June 2, 1929 ~ November 1, 2020
Joe Ann Hayworth, 91, of Columbus, died at 8:00 PM, November 1, 2020, at her residence.
Joe Ann was born June 2, 1929 in Bartholomew Co. IN, the daughter of Louis and Mae (McKain) Williams.
Joe Ann was a loving mother and grandmother and was a lifelong member of the First United Methodist Church of Columbus. She graduated from Hope High School and worked in the insurance business for 30 years. She enjoyed reading and gardening.
Private graveside services will be held Friday November 6, 2020 at Garland Brook Cemetery with the Rev. Howard Boles officiating.
Memorials contributions in memory of Joe Ann may be made to Our Hospice of South Central Indiana.
She is survived by her sons; Bruce (Maggie) Hayworth of Boise Idaho and Gary (Kathy) Hayworth of Colorado Springs Colorado; daughters; Linda Hayworth and Lizbeth Siegelin, both of Columbus; grandchildren; Aaron (Michelle) Grissom, Beth (James) Overton, Jessica Hayworth, Jeff (Amanda) Hayworth and Justin (Ashley) Hayworth; nine great-grandchildren and special friends Darla Hill and Jeff Bailey.
She was preceded in death by her parents; brothers, John Williams, Reed Williams, James Noble Williams, Louis Williams; sisters Margaret Jean (Williams) Cline, June (Williams) Rhoades, Mary K. (Williams) Lucas, Martha E. (Williams) Taylor and a son-in-law Darrell Siegelin
Services were entrusted to the Jewell-Rittman Family Funeral Home.
